Disability shower installation services focus on modifying or creating showers that accommodate individuals with mobility challenges or physical disabilities. These services typically involve installing features such as low-threshold or curbless entryways, grab bars, non-slip flooring, and seating options to enhance safety and accessibility. The goal is to create a bathroom environment that allows for easier and more independent use, reducing the need for assistance and minimizing the risk of slips or falls.
These installations address common problems faced by individuals with limited mobility, such as difficulty stepping over high thresholds or maintaining balance in traditional shower setups. By customizing showers to meet specific needs, these services help improve safety, comfort, and usability. They also assist caregivers and family members by making daily routines less strenuous and reducing potential hazards within the bathroom space.

Installation Costs - The cost for disability shower installation services typically ranges from $1,500 to $4,000, depending on the scope of work and materials used. For example, a basic accessible shower setup might be around $1,800, while more complex modifications can exceed $3,500.
Material Expenses - The price of materials such as waterproof tiles, grab bars, and low-threshold bases generally varies between $200 and $1,200. Higher-end fixtures or custom features can increase overall expenses beyond this range.
Labor Fees - Labor costs for installing disability showers usually fall between $500 and $2,000. The final fee depends on factors like existing plumbing, shower size, and accessibility requirements.
Additional Costs - Additional expenses may include permits, structural modifications, or specialized fixtures, which can add $300 to $1,000 or more. These costs vary based on local regulations and specific project needs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
